Job Description:
POSITION OVERVIEW:This role requires expertise in Digital
Front-End (DFE) devices, wide-format printers, and related software
applications. The successful candidate will have a strong technical
background and a customer-facing role, providing expert-level
training and pre-sale support. This position demands an individual
who can collaborate with customers to understand their needs, offer
tailored solutions, and provide support during the sales
process.K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:EFI Fiery System Support: Provide
expert-level technical support and troubleshooting for EFI Fiery
digital front-end systems, ensuring efficient operation and
integration with wide-format printers and other digital printing
devices.Customer-Facing Engagement: Act as a key point of contact
for customers, delivering training on Fiery solutions and
applications, and ensuring clients fully understand the product's
capabilities.Pre-Sale Support & Scope of Work: Collaborate with the
sales team to define the scope of work for pre-sale activities,
providing technical expertise and identifying the right EFI Fiery
solutions for customer needs.Wide Format Printer Integration: Work
with wide-format printing systems, ensuring seamless integration
with Fiery controllers and other associated
hardware/software.Solution Design: Collaborate with customers to
design optimal printing solutions based on their requirements,
ensuring the integration of EFI Fiery solutions with their
workflow.Training & Knowledge Transfer: Conduct in-depth training
sessions for customers, both on-site and remotely, to ensure a
thorough understanding of the EFI Fiery system and associated
software applications.Documentation: Maintain accurate
documentation of configurations, system installations, training
materials, and customer interactions.Problem Resolution:
Troubleshoot and resolve technical issues related to Fiery
software, digital front-end devices, and printers, offering timely
solutions to ensure minimal downtime for customers.REQUIRED SKILLS
